Abstract

The authors study the effect of the spontaneous polarization of a ferroelectric liquid crystal mixture with compensated helix and of the thickness of the alignment layer on the analog switching in a cell. The quality of analog switching is established in terms of its contrast ratio, texture in the dark state, and the electrostatic energy.
